Rooms
Best Western Art Hotel offers 36 air-conditioned accommodations with minibars and welcome amenities. LCD televisions come with satellite channels and pay movies. Bathrooms include shower/tub combinations with handheld showerheads, slippers, makeup/shaving mirrors, and hair dryers.
This Split hotel provides complimentary wired and wireless high-speed Internet access. Business-friendly amenities include desks and safes, as well as multi-line phones; free local calls are provided (restrictions may apply). Additionally, rooms include complimentary bottled water and coffee/tea makers. Housekeeping is offered daily and wake-up calls can be requested.

Dining
Best Western Art Hotel has a restaurant serving breakfast and lunch. Guests are offered a complimentary buffet breakfast. Room service during limited hours is available.

Split, Croatia: Commanding a splendid coastal site, its palm-lined seafront promenade backed by rugged mountains, Split is Croatias second city after Zagreb. The UNESCO-listed old town lies within the walls of Emperor Diocletians 3rd-century Roman palace. The pedestrian-only, marble-paved streets and piazzas are filled with medieval stone buildings, cafes and boutiques. Daily ferries serve the nearby islands and many yacht charter companies are based here.
